Output 517c33f051e4de89352a54425e26e88e83bc79521b840cf23b96de00e16e3dca:0

value
9806096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f4634c8d7b3c93f9c61826bd00c997fe8c4108f OP_EQUAL
address
3LayuGH6chURxhGUUhtFoEFvpi7DiqKAc8
transaction
517c33f051e4de89352a54425e26e88e83bc79521b840cf23b96de00e16e3dca
spent
true